      <abstract>Estuary geomorphic units delineated at a scale of 1:1500 using a combination of (a) 26 August 2013 0.15 meter resolution NPS Elwha PlaneCam aerial imagery; and (b) elevation-colored and hillshaded digital elevation models from USGS backpack/jetski topobathy surveys (16 September 2013) for areas &lt; MHHW and aerial lidar surveys (17 October 2012) supplemented with NPS Elwha PlaneCam SfM photogrammetry data (19 September 2013) for elevations &gt; MHHW.</abstract>
      <purpose>Data were collected/produced to monitor and assess changes to coastal habitats during dam removal on the Elwha River, Clallam County, WA, USA.</purpose>

        <procdesc>Delineate geomorphic units from aerial imagery and elevation data using combination of three layers for interpretation: (1) aerial imagery to map bars, beaches, and aquatic habitat, (2) elevation-colored DEMs to identify subtidal, intertidal, and supratidal regions, (3) hillshaded DEMs to assist in mapping feature boundaries.</procdesc>
